A fluorescent light starter is a small, cylindrical device that plays a crucial role in the operation of a fluorescent light bulb. It is typically located near the ballast, which regulates the electrical current flowing through the bulb. The starter acts as a trigger mechanism to initiate the electrical discharge that produces light in the fluorescent tube.

The starter consists of a tiny gas discharge tube with two electrodes at either end. When the light switch is turned on, the starter closes the electrical circuit and allows the current to flow through the tube. The electrical current generates a high-voltage pulse that ignites the gas inside the tube, creating a burst of light that activates the fluorescent bulb.

Without the starter, the electrical discharge necessary to create light in the fluorescent tube would not be possible. The starter’s role is particularly crucial in older fluorescent fixtures that use magnetic ballasts, as these fixtures require a separate device to initiate the electrical discharge. In newer electronic ballasts, the starter function is often integrated into the ballast itself, eliminating the need for a separate starter device.

While fluorescent light starters may seem like small and insignificant components, they are essential for the proper functioning of fluorescent light fixtures. A faulty or worn-out starter can cause a fluorescent bulb to flicker, take a long time to start, or fail to light up altogether. In such cases, replacing the starter is often the most effective solution to restore the light fixture to its optimal performance.

To replace a fluorescent light starter, simply turn off the power to the light fixture, remove the fluorescent bulb and the starter cover, and unscrew the old starter from its socket. Take note of the starter’s model number and specifications before purchasing a replacement starter to ensure compatibility with your specific light fixture. Once you have a new starter, insert it into the socket, replace the starter cover, reinsert the fluorescent bulb, and turn the power back on to test the fixture.
